You cut the end cap off and remove the internal baffle. It will also make it louder so I have heard.
I just opened up the tail pipe by cutting off the 5/8 tip and welding a 3/4 inside diameter 2 inch long pipe to a washer and welding it to the muffler. This was done after I drilled out and grinded a 1 1/4 opening and found it was stupid loud and by not jetting it up it got hot and the intake valve seat came out and bent the valve, end of motor. At least the motor was 3 years old. The performance was worse due to no back pressure.

So I came up with the 3/4 tail pipe when I found that a old set of bmx handle bars sitting in the garage was the perfect tail pipe size to get a little more flow and keep back pressure.

On my 6t8 chevelle with my built 350 I went from dual 2 1/2 to dual 3 inch flowmasters and it sounded awesome but killed the overall performance. Put 2 1/2 tail pipes on and it came back. On nitrous it liked the 3 inch but on the motor it liked the 2 1/2.

Also if you ride in your neighborhood you might not want to open the muffler too much. These little 150cc motors can be crazy loud with a straight pipe.

Just my opinion but if you do go bigger jet your carb up because lean is mean.
